§ 112.46 MANAGER BOND.
   (A)   (1)   All operation of and the conduct of raffles and poker runs shall be under the supervision of a single manager designated by the licensed organization. The manager must be a bona fide member of the organization holding the license for such a raffle or poker run and may not receive any remuneration or profit for participating in the management or operation of the raffle or poker run.
      (2)   In the case of Class A and B raffles, the manager shall provide a fidelity bond in a sum equal to the aggregate retail value of all prizes or merchandise awarded in the raffle, with two sureties thereon who are residents of the state, and who are acceptable to the issuing authority, or with a solvent surety company licensed to do business in the state, in favor of the sponsoring licensee conditioned upon his or her honesty and performance of his or her duties. Terms of the bond shall provide that notice shall be given in writing to the Commission not less than 30 days prior to its cancellation. The issuing authority shall consider the bond and shall have the right to disapprove the bond.
      (3)   In the case of Class C and D raffles and poker runs, the manager shall give a fidelity bond in a sum equal to the aggregate retail value of all prizes and merchandise to be awarded in the raffle with a solvent surety bond company licensed to do business in the state, in favor of the sponsoring licensee, conditioned upon his or her honesty and performance of his or her duties. Terms of the bond shall provide that notice be given in writing to the Commission not less than 30 days prior to its cancellation. The issuing authority shall consider the bond and shall have the right to disapprove the bond.
      (4)   Fidelity bonds shall be conditioned upon the faithful observance by the licensee of this subchapter upon the provisions of all laws of the state and the United States of America applying to raffles.
   (B)   The issuing authority may, in its discretion, waive the bond requirement for Class A raffles only, subject to the following conditions:
      (1)   Upon the unanimous vote to the members of the licensed organization that said requirements maybe waived;
      (2)   A written waiver is filed with the application for the license;
      (3)   The license application must contain a sworn statement attesting to the unanimous vote of the members of the licensed organization signed by the presiding officer and the secretary of said organization; and
      (4)   All licenses issued to the organization shall include a provision that the fidelity bond has been waived.
